Body

Origins and Family

Recorded place of birth include Uppsala[2], an urban area in Sweden[27], in Sweden[28] and Uppsala Cathedral Assembly[7], a parish of the Church of Sweden[29], in Sweden[30], founded in 1550[31]. Aksel Josephson was born on +1860-10-02T00:00:00Z[3]. His father was Jacob Axel Josephson[8].

Education

Aksel Josephson's education included a stint at New York State Library School[14].

Career and Affiliations

Aksel Josephson worked as a librarian[6]. Employers include John Crerar Library[11], a research library[32], in United States[33], founded in 1894[34], headquartered in Hyde Park[35]; Publishers Weekly[12], a magazine[36], in United States[37], founded in 1872[38]; and New York Public Library[13], a library network[39], in United States[40], founded in 1895[41], headquartered in New York City[42].

Death and Burial

Aksel Josephson died on +1944-12-12T00:00:00Z[5]. He died in Mobile City Hospital[4].
